A ray runs forever in _______ directions. a. one b.two c.three d.four

Mathematics
2 answers:
kipiarov [429]3 years ago
5 0
I believe the correct answer from the choices listed above is option A. A ray runs forever in only one direction. <span>A </span>ray<span> starts at a given point and goes off in a certain direction forever, to infinity. </span>Hope this answers the question. Have a nice day.
